Choose the Right Battery
The battery is the heart of an electric freight tricycle, and it plays a significant role in determining the range. When selecting a battery, you need to consider its capacity, voltage, and type. Lithium-ion batteries are a popular choice these days because they offer a high energy density, which means they can store more energy in a smaller and lighter package compared to lead-acid batteries. This not only helps to increase the range but also reduces the overall weight of the tricycle, which in turn improves its efficiency.
For example, if you're using a Household Cargo Tricycle for light-duty tasks around the neighborhood, a lithium-ion battery with a capacity of 48V and 20Ah might be sufficient. However, if you're using a Heavy Duty Electric Cargo Tricycle for long-haul deliveries or carrying heavy loads, you might want to consider a higher-capacity battery, such as a 60V or 72V battery with a larger Ah rating.
It's also important to maintain your battery properly to ensure its longevity and performance. Avoid overcharging or discharging the battery, as this can damage the cells and reduce its capacity over time.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for charging and storage, and make sure to keep the battery clean and dry.
Optimize the Motor and Controller
The motor and controller are another important factors that affect the range of an electric freight tricycle. A high-efficiency motor can convert more electrical energy into mechanical energy, which means it can use less power to achieve the same level of performance. Look for motors that are designed specifically for electric vehicles and have a high power-to-weight ratio.
The controller, on the other hand, regulates the flow of electricity from the battery to the motor. A good controller can optimize the power output based on the speed and load of the tricycle, which helps to improve the overall efficiency. Some controllers also offer features such as regenerative braking, which can recover some of the energy lost during braking and store it back in the battery.
When choosing a motor and controller, make sure they are compatible with each other and with the battery. You may also want to consider upgrading to a more advanced motor and controller if you're looking to improve the range of your electric freight tricycle.
Reduce the Weight and Resistance
The weight and resistance of the tricycle can have a significant impact on its range. The heavier the tricycle and the more resistance it encounters, the more power it will need to move forward. Therefore, it's important to try to reduce the weight of the tricycle as much as possible without compromising its strength and durability.
One way to reduce the weight is to choose lightweight materials for the frame and components. For example, aluminum alloy frames are lighter than steel frames, and they also offer good corrosion resistance. You can also consider removing any unnecessary accessories or equipment from the tricycle to reduce the weight.
In addition to reducing the weight, you also need to minimize the resistance. This can be achieved by using low-rolling-resistance tires, which have a smoother tread pattern and are designed to reduce the friction between the tires and the road. You should also keep the tires properly inflated, as under-inflated tires can increase the rolling resistance and reduce the range.
Another way to reduce the resistance is to improve the aerodynamics of the tricycle. This can be done by adding fairings or windshields to the tricycle to reduce the drag caused by the wind. However, it's important to note that improving the aerodynamics may also increase the cost and complexity of the tricycle.
Drive Efficiently
The way you drive the electric freight tricycle can also have a big impact on its range. By adopting some efficient driving habits, you can extend the range of the tricycle and save energy.
One of the most important things you can do is to avoid sudden acceleration and braking. These actions require a lot of power and can quickly drain the battery. Instead, try to accelerate and decelerate gradually and smoothly. You can also use the regenerative braking feature if your tricycle has it to recover some of the energy lost during braking.
Another tip is to maintain a steady speed. Driving at a constant speed is more efficient than constantly changing the speed. You should also try to avoid driving on hilly or rough terrain, as this can increase the resistance and reduce the range. If you need to drive on hilly terrain, try to use the lowest gear possible to reduce the load on the motor.
Finally, make sure to plan your route in advance and avoid unnecessary detours or stops. This can help you save time and energy, and it can also extend the range of the tricycle.
Consider Hybrid Options
If you need to travel long distances or carry heavy loads on a regular basis, you might want to consider a hybrid electric freight tricycle, such as an Oil Electric Tricycle. These tricycles combine an electric motor with a small gasoline or diesel engine, which can provide additional power when needed.
Hybrid tricycles offer several advantages over pure electric tricycles. They have a longer range, as the engine can be used to charge the battery or provide additional power when the battery is low. They also offer more flexibility, as you can switch between electric and gasoline/diesel power depending on the situation.
However, hybrid tricycles also have some disadvantages. They are generally more expensive than pure electric tricycles, and they also require more maintenance. You need to make sure to keep the engine properly tuned and serviced to ensure its reliability and performance.
